Styling Tips the Actress Popularized

You can steal her exact routine. Sophia bush short hair relies on a few non-negotiable products. Start with a volumizing mousse on damp hair. Blow-dry using your fingers, not a brush. Tousle the roots while the ends still dry.

A flat iron creates the sleek, corporate version of the cut. A diffuser attachment builds the messy, lived-in texture. Sea salt spray adds grit without looking crunchy. Sophia often left a small piece loose near her temple. That single strand softened the entire look.

Maintenance frequency increases with shorter lengths. The roots demand attention every three weeks. Regular trims prevent the style from growing out unevenly. The cut punishes neglect quickly.
